Maybe if they built one that was one piece and not adjustable and in another color like white or yellow they could take the market. I saw these at Academy as well and almost got one but was told they don't allow adjustable fish measuring boards in most tournaments. And since I plan to try and fish a small tournament sometime this year I bought a hawg trough. But maybe this company will listen to some customer input and build what we all want......

If you're going to go the foam insulation route, like above, make certain you used closed cell foam. Alternatively, GREAT STUFF foam is closed cell and will stick into the grooves w/o added adhesive being necessary.
